Output 01598db90425c78902ffc8258e3134c0fdd87989784f153cbe8c86b407c87a59:0

value
470921
script pubkey
OP_0 OP_PUSHBYTES_20 586b70d2a63c3bf3f2e70d7b407711725a2d93cd
address
bc1qtp4hp54x8sal8uh8p4a5qac3wfdzmy7ddcn7v7
transaction
01598db90425c78902ffc8258e3134c0fdd87989784f153cbe8c86b407c87a59
spent
true